Vazhaipoo Poriyal | Banana Flower Stir Fry

Vazhaipoo Poriyal is a bland & healthy side dish made by sautéing vazhaipoo with spices, onions and curry leaves. Vazhaipoo Poriyal is good alternate to regular veggie poriyal and a must try at home. How to make Banana Flower Stir Fry is presented in this post with step by step pictures.

Ingredients

  • 1 vazhaipoo / banana flower
  • 3 tablespoon moong dal paasi paruppu
  • a generous pinch turmeric powder
  • 1.5 teaspoon jeera
  • 3 tablespoon coconut grated
  • 4 to 5 pearls garlic chopped finely
  • 1 small sized big onion chopped
  • salt as needed
  • 1 teaspoon oil

To Temper:

  • 1/2 teaspoon mustard seeds
  • 1/2 teaspoon urad dal
  • few curry leaves
  • 1 green chillies slitted

Instructions

  • Clean vazhaipoo as mentioned in the link above and soak in buttermilk until use, Keep aside.
  • Then dry roast jeera for few mins until aroma comes then grind it to a semi fine powder.
  • In a pan, heat oil – add mustard seeds, urad dhal let it splutter.
  • Then add curry leaves, green chillies, onion and garlic, moong dhal and saute until onions turn slightly browned.
  • Drain buttermilk / water then add vazhaipoo, turmeric powder and saute for a minute.
  • Then add water till immersing level and allow it to boil and cook till the veggie turns soft.
  • Saute for few mins until the moisture evaporates and the curry becomes dry and roasted.
  • It may take 5 -7 mins then add grated coconut, roasted jeera powder and stir well for 2-3mins.
  • Switch off. Serve Vazhaipoo poriyal hot with rice and sambar or any variety rice of your choice.

Notes

  • You can even cook vazhaipoo and moong dal in a pan with water. But I prefer pressure cooking.
  • Moong dal should not be mushy, it should be firm yet soft to bite.
  • Don't skip roasting moong dal, it gives a nice aroma.
